特比萘芬与氟康唑或伊曲康唑体外联合对白色念珠菌的后效应  被引量:6

Postantifungal Effect of Terbinafine Combined with Fluconazole or Itraconazole Against Candida Albicans

摘  要:目的探讨特比萘芬与氟康唑或伊曲康唑体外联合对白色念珠菌的后效应。方法先将白色念珠菌YO1∶19在1/2最低抑菌浓度(MIC)氟康唑的沙堡培养基上培养,然后在含10%正常人新鲜血清的RPMI1640液体培养基中培养,采用洗涤离心法和菌落计数法测定特比萘芬与氟康唑或伊曲康唑体外联合对白色念珠菌的后效应。结果单用特比萘芬、氟康唑、伊曲康唑对氟康唑预处理的白色念珠菌均有抗真菌后效应的作用,联合用药组较相应的单用药组抗真菌后效应时间长,并能产生相加作用。结论特比萘芬与氟康唑或伊曲康唑联合应用能延长对白色念珠菌的后效应,可延长给药的间隔时间。Objective To investigate the postantifungal effect (PAFE) of Terbinafine combined with Fluconazole or Itraconazole against candida albicans. Methods Candida albieans YO1 : 19 was cultured in 1/2 MIC Fluconazole's sandhurg culture media, then in the liquid culture media of RPMI1640. PAFE was detected by washing- centrifuging method and colony - counting mehod. Results Single Terbinafine, Fluconazole or Itraconazole had postantifungal effect on candida albicans treated by Fluconazole in advance, but the combination of Terbinafine with Fluconazole or Itraconazole had longer PAFET than the single drug, which could produce the adding function. Conclusion Terbinafine combined with Fluconazole or Itraconazole can enhance PAFE and prolong the dosing interval.
